Different Types of Bingo Games

Bingo is an exciting game, despite its simplicity. When playing online it’s even more exciting, because there’s an interesting and varied selection of games you can play.

Most sites have dozens upon dozens of different games so it’s almost impossible to get bored. You could play a different game every day for a year at some sites and still not play them all.

We couldn’t even begin to start listing each and every bingo game you’ll find online, because it would take us forever to finish.

Besides, there are lots of bingo sites on the web and most of them regularly introduce new games. Even if we did compile a list it would soon be out of date.

What we can do, though, is tell you about the main types of bingo games. These are 30 ball, 75 ball, 80 ball, and 90 ball.

The rules for each of these are pretty much the same; it’s always about marking off numbers on game cards, but there are some differences between them. We’ve explained a little bit about each type below.

30 Ball Bingo

This type of bingo is also known as speed bingo. This is because, with just 30 balls in play, the games are really quick. At the moment the number of games like this type are pretty low at most sites, and some sites don’t even offer any 30 ball games at all.

There are several that have a good selection though, and it’s growing in popularity all the time.

The fact that it’s so quick is appealing to many players.

Game cards in 30 ball contain nine numbers, filling each square in a three square by three square grid. There’s usually only one prize up for grabs in each game, and that’s awarded to the first player to mark of all their numbers.

75 Ball Bingo

75 ball is generally accepted as the game of choice in the United States. That’s certainly where it’s the most popular among players. You’ll find many variations of this game at most sites, and particularly at those that market towards US players.

The game cards contain five columns and five rows, for a total of 25 squares. The middle square is blank and the other 24 each contain a number. The letters B, I, N, G, O appear at the top of the columns, and each column contains numbers from a specific range. The B column is for numbers 1-15, the I column for numbers 16-30, and so on.

The traditional rules of 75 ball are that the first player to mark off any complete line: horizontally, vertically or diagonally – is the winner. These days there are different patterns that can be required to win a game. These vary from one version of the game to another.

80 Ball Bingo

This type of game was developed specifically for playing online and has proved to be very popular. As such, you’ll find many variations of 80 ball bingo at most sites.

It’s played using game cards containing a grid four squares by four squares, with one number in each grid square for a total of 16 numbers.

Just like in 75 ball bingo, the cards are always arranged so that each column contains only numbers from within a specific range. The first column is for the numbers 1-20, the second column is for the numbers 21-40, and so on. As always the winner is the first to mark off the required pattern on their game card.

Again like in 75 ball, the patterns required will be different depending on which variation of the game is being played. Common patterns include a vertical line, a horizontal line, all four corners, or even every single number.

90 Ball Bingo

90 ball is the game of choice in several regions including the United Kingdom and Australia. Most bingo sites have at least a few variations of 90 ball bingo, and some of them offer a great many.

It’s by no means a complicated form of bingo, but this type of game is ever so slightly less simple than the others as there are usually three rounds.

The game cards used each contain 15 numbers. There are five numbers in each one of the three rows on the card, spread randomly across nine columns. With 90 balls in play the numbers are between 1 and 90. Each column can only contain numbers from within a specified range. The first column is for numbers 1-9, the second column is for numbers 10-19, and so on.

  • Typically the first round is won by the first player to mark off a complete horizontal line.
  • That player wins a prize.

  • The second round is then won by the first player to mark two complete horizontal lines, who also wins a prize.
  • Usually this is a little larger than the prize for winning the first round.

  • The third round is then won by the player who marks of all their numbers first.

They will win the largest prize.

These are the traditional rules, but they are by no means set in stone and there are different variations where other rules apply.
